Job Description:
-
The successful candidate will work closely with stakeholders in the Quantitative Medicine and Genomics (QM&G) organization to develop predictive AI/ML models using large-scale transcriptomic and imaging datasets to elucidate drug mechanism of action (MOA). Key responsibilities can include ingesting public data, performing data clean-up to ensure model compatibility, integrating external and internal datasets, and optimizing multi-model models. This role offers the opportunity to make a direct impact on drug development by delivering innovative data science solutions across cross-functional projects.
